Elderly bathroom remodeling services focus on making bathrooms safer, more accessible, and easier to use for seniors or individuals with mobility challenges. These projects often involve installing grab bars, non-slip flooring, walk-in showers, and higher toilet seats to reduce the risk of falls and improve overall safety. Additionally, contractors may update fixtures and layout elements to create a more functional space that accommodates changing needs. By customizing the bathroom environment, these renovations aim to promote independence and comfort for elderly residents.

Many common problems addressed through elderly bathroom remodeling include difficulty stepping into or out of the bathtub or shower, trouble maintaining balance, and challenges reaching or using fixtures comfortably. Limited mobility can make traditional bathroom setups hazardous, increasing the likelihood of slips and falls. Remodeling can also help eliminate obstacles such as high thresholds or tight spaces that make movement difficult. These improvements not only enhance safety but also reduce the stress and inconvenience often associated with aging or mobility impairments.

The overview below groups typical Elderly Bathroom Remodeling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Columbia, SC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or bathroom upgrades such as grab bar installation or replacing fixtures range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on specific needs and materials.

Shower and Tub Replacement - Replacing a shower or bathtub us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Larger, more complex projects, including custom installations, can reach $4,500 or higher, but most projects stay within the mid-range.

Full Bathroom Remodels - Complete renovations, including new fixtures, flooring, and accessibility features, typically cost $8,000 to $15,000. These larger projects are less common and tend to push into higher pricing tiers depending on scope and finishes.

Accessibility Modifications - Installing features like walk-in tubs or wheelchair-accessible showers generally ranges from $3,000 to $10,000. Many local contractors handle these modifications within the middle to upper ranges, depending on the level of customization needed.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of bathroom modifications are suitable for elderly residents? Local contractors can assist with installing grab bars, walk-in showers, non-slip flooring, and other modifications to improve safety and accessibility for seniors.

How can bathroom remodeling improve safety for elderly users? Remodeling can include features like barrier-free entry, sturdy grab bars, and slip-resistant surfaces to reduce fall risks and enhance overall safety.

Are there specific design considerations for elderly-friendly bathrooms? Yes, local service providers often recommend features such as ergonomic fixtures, adequate lighting, and accessible storage to support ease of use for seniors.

Can bathroom renovations accommodate mobility aids like walkers or wheelchairs? Many contractors can modify bathrooms with wider doorways, lowered sinks, and roll-in showers to support mobility devices and ease movement.

What should be considered when choosing materials for an elderly bathroom remodel? Durable, slip-resistant, and easy-to-clean materials are typically recommended to ensure safety and low maintenance for aging users.
